All Souls’ Day has passed. My son Marcus also went just recently in Mexico when the famous El Dia de los Muertos [The Day of the Dead] was also being celebrated. Know more:

Remembering “death” has always been poignant for me. I have always looked forward to visiting the cemetery annually pre-pandemic to “update” parted loved ones and continuously seek their guidance. This would include my great grandparents, my grandparents and my grand aunt. This year, I also remember my godfather, Jone Wong, who I once thought lived permanently in The Manila Hotel, and who would always spend great conversation time with me when I visited Hong Kong.

This year, I was also directed to relationships that have passed. To commemorate them, here is an essay I wrote for our school paper, called The Judenites, back in 1991. The essay is titled,“Life has all its moods. Sometimes it gives you all the laughter and at other times, all the tears. In both cases, you need people to share those moments with. In short, the world is not your own, you need friends to share the tone.

“Not long ago, about two years back, I met a person who never failed to comfort and accompany me in whatever I pursue. He enabled me to overcome the pressures of everyday life. He was a normal person, not a genius or a super famous personality, just a person who followed the high tides and the low tides of time. But for me, he was as special as diamonds locked in one’s heart. He served as the bridge and inspiration to all my dreams and desires.

“But as time passed by, lessons are learned and experiences are gained. Though I want the friendship back, I know it can never be. I realized that good things never last. Maybe it was not our time. But I know now that when one leans too much, the post may not be as firm as you want it to be and may just break apart.
